Fake news causes billions in damage—politically, economically, and socially. The Pforzheimer Beitrag No. 189, “Fake News,” by Hanno Beck and Aloys Prinz, explains what distinguishes fake news from opinion and propaganda, why it spreads so rapidly, and what psychological mechanisms facilitate its spread. It analyzes the actors involved, the costs, and countermeasures—and explains why media literacy is the most effective weapon against disinformation in the long term. You can find the article here.
